In late 2014 I launched another website that was based on flash games. I called it The Arcade Corner. In the beginning, I was like this is not going well what am I doing wrong? I realized that the biggest thing, that the competition and I differ in, is backlinks. Many arcade websites link trade but if a search engine catches on you are bound to get a hit to your traffic. This leads me to getting valuable backlinks through social media. Now my games are posted to social media accounts, several times a day generating valuable back links, and my traffic is increasing. My traffic in the beginning was about 10 visitors a day... In one month of using my own social media accounts, I was able to get 100 visitors a day. While this is not a lot, this is from an effort that took me 1 hour to implement.
